JMPM Consultancy is available to provide individuals with the
necessary assistance, training and knowledge to operate a successful
board & care home ( also known as "Assisted Living, Elderly
Care Home, Retirement Home, Home Care, Elderly Living, Board &
Care, etc.) or Intermediate Care Facility (Developmentally Disabled
Habilitative/Nursing).
JMPM was conceptualized to assist potential applicants and
current licensees to adequately achieve compliance with Health
and Safety Code Regulations: Title 22, Title 17 and Health Care
Facility Administration Guidelines. It was formed as a joint
venture by a husband and wife team experienced in the fields of:
Mental Health Education, Health Care, Gerontology and Developmental
Disabilities.

JMPM is an approved vendor by the Department of Social Services,
Community Care Licensing Division for the State of California,
conducting the Initial 40 Hour Residential Care Facilities for
the Elderly Administrator Certification Program and Continuing
(Administrator C.E.U.) Education classes. Furthermore, JMPM is
recognized and approved by the Department of Developmental Services,
as Quality Assurance And Educational Consultants to various Intermediate
Care Facilities for individuals with Developmental Disabilities.
JMPM offers a wide range of extensive services in the following
areas, but are not limited to:
a.) 40 Hours R.C.F.E. Initial Administrator and Continuing Education
Certification Program (Vendor No. 100003),
b.) Intermediate Care Facility (D.D.H. or D.D.N.) Program Development
and Design, Maintenance of Certification standards,
c.) Consultancy Services: Assistance with the initial application
for board and care licensure, etc.
